What is HGH FRAGMENT 176-191?

Derived from amino acids 176-191 of human growth hormone, this synthetic fragment represents an attempt to isolate the fat-burning properties of HGH while eliminating its growth-promoting effects. Researchers developed it specifically to study lipolysis without the complications of full growth hormone activity. Most investigation focuses on whether targeted fat metabolism can be achieved without affecting insulin sensitivity or triggering unwanted growth responses.

This fragment targets the same receptors as full growth hormone but only activates pathways related to fat cell breakdown, theoretically bypassing the metabolic and growth cascades triggered by complete HGH. The peptide appears to enhance lipolysis by increasing the activity of hormone-sensitive lipase, the enzyme responsible for breaking down stored triglycerides into free fatty acids. Think of it as trying to use just one key from growth hormone's master key ring - specifically the one that unlocks fat stores.

What the Research Shows

Research consists primarily of theoretical frameworks and isolated in vitro studies, with no substantial clinical trials or human safety data.

Based on a single preclinical study with no human trials or randomized controlled trials, HGH fragment 176-191 demonstrated enhanced cytotoxicity of doxorubicin-loaded chitosan nanoparticles against MCF-7 breast cancer cells in vitro. No clinical efficacy or safety data in humans currently exists for this peptide.
